Timing issue occurs on eMMC not only when modifying the frequency but also for all the switch command(CMD6). According to the MMC spec waiting 8 clocks after a switch command would be the thing to do.
This patch allows fixing CPU hang observed when trying to changing the bus width on a eMMC on SAMA5D4.
